Executive Secretary of the Creative Arts Agency (CAA), Gideon Aryequaye has encourage Ghanaian artistes to emulate the consistency of late Highlife music icon, Daddy Lumba.

Daddy Lumba’s Playboy album cover

In a phone call interview on Top Radio’s Drive time show Top Pawa Drive, he mentioned that the legacy of Daddy Lumba is illustrious and should be preserved for future generations.

“When you are writing songs.. even when you are talking about love, you are talking about love responsibly and so on and so forth. And be consistent, if you know you come out with an album or a track and people love it don go sleeping”, Gideon Aryequaye told Londona on July 28, 2025.

Speaking about how younger Ghanaian artistes can sustain their music career for longer, he said:

“The young once must take a que from them, make sure you sustain yourself in the industry.. that will be a pacifier but the truth is that there is none like him, he is an era and that era is gone.

Daddy Lumba died in the early morning of 26 July 2025, at the age of 60 while under going treatment at the Bank Hospital, located in Cantonments.

2000 Ghana Music Awards – Artist of the Year, Best Album of the Year, Most Popular Song of the Year at the 2000 Ghana Music Awards.

In commemoration of the 2025 Commonwealth day, King Charles III listed Daddy Lumba’s ‘Mpempem Do Me’ song as one of his favorite tunes. The song ranked seventh out of 17 songs on King Charles’s “the kings music room” playlist on Apple.
